Over a hundred people-including some tea party protesters-- packed Franklin Town Hall on Saturday morning for a public hearing about plans to build a new border inspection station on the Canadian border at Morses Line. The Department of Homeland Security wants to buy or, if necessary, take land from a local farmer to expand the facility. Now, Senator Patrick Leahy is asking Homeland Security Secretary Janet Napolitano to close the crossing, saying he'll use the Appropriations process if necessary. Continued |
